Side-by-side financial comparison of BYLINE BANCORP, INC. (BY) and MAXLINEAR, INC (MXL).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

MAXLINEAR, INC is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($137.2M vs $112.4M, roughly 1.2× BYLINE BANCORP, INC.). BYLINE BANCORP, INC. runs the higher net margin — 33.4% vs -32.9%, a 66.3%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, MAXLINEAR, INC pos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(43.0% vs 9.0%). Over the past eight quarters, MAXLINEAR, INC's revenue compounded faster (22.1% CAGR vs 6.4%).

Byline Bank is a bank head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, United States. It is the primary subsidiary of Byline Bancorp, Inc., a bank holding company, and the 4th largest SBA 7(a) lender.

MaxLinear, Inc. is an American electronic hardware company. Founded in 2003, it provides highly integrated radio-frequency (RF) analog and mixed-signal semiconductor products for broadband communications applications. It is a New York Stock Exchange-traded company.
